NCL-Norwegian Cruise Line launched the "CruiseFirst" - a value-add program offering passengers both additional savings and increased flexibility when booking their NCL cruise in 2021 and beyond.

CruiseFirst certificates allow guests to receive a US$300 value coupon for the cost of US$150, where they have 3 years from the purchase date to apply the certificate to any new reservation across Norwegian’s 17-ship fleet, visiting 300+ destinations worldwide.

CruiseFirst certificates are easily combinable with nearly all public promotions of which NCL's currently running bestselling deal of the year: 30% off a cruise on any ship plus all 5 Free at Sea offers including free specialty dining, free open bar, free shore trips credits, free WiFi, discounted rates for family and friends - a value of US$2,900+.

From January 1, 2021, to March 31, 2021, in order to provide support to travel partners, advisors are due to receive a Wave Season US$50 gift card bonus on the purchase of each NCL CruiseFirst certificate. Advisors will also benefit from a full commission on the reservation of the new booking that is made using the line's CruiseFirst certificate. Commissions are to be paid based on Norwegian’s standard commission policy.
